Description: OverviewTaxonomyDescriptionDistribution and habitatBehaviourConservation statusExternal linksThe eastern wood pewee (Contopus virens) is a small tyrant flycatcher from North America. This bird and the western wood pewee (C. sordidulus) were formerly considered a single species. The two species are virtually identical in appearance, and can be distinguished most easily by their calls.
